Planning appeal decision

Dismissed8 September 20233305922

Cressida Red Road, Wootton Bridge, RYDE, PO33 4PQ

described on the application form as, “Extensions and conversion to provide 2 dwellings

Authority
Isle of Wight Council
Appeal type
minor · Planning Appeal
Procedure
Written Representations
Development
residential · Minor Dwellings
Inspector
O'Doherty A

Main issues, as the Inspector framed them

  • the effect of the proposed development on the character and appearance of the area
  • the effect of the proposed development on the living conditions of the occupiers of the dwelling known as Sighisoara, with particular regard to outlook

What decided it

The significant weight given to the adverse impacts on character and appearance and neighbouring living conditions substantially outweighed the moderate weight of housing and environmental benefits, such that the presumption in favour of sustainable development did not apply.
